Bloomberg editor-in-chief Matthew Winkler has resigned. His place was taken by John Mickelthwaite, who previously served as editor-in-chief of The Economist.
Winkler is the co-founder of the Bloomberg agency, which he co-created with Michael Bloomberg. Matthew Winkler has led the agency since its inception in 1990. Prior to that, he worked for The Wall Street Journal. Winkler is the co-author of a book about Michael Bloomberg, as well as a guide for journalists called Bloomberg Way.
